Police: Man used pizza to fight robber

Published: Dec. 12, 2008 at 8:35 PM

MIRAMAR, Fla., Dec. 12 (UPI) -- Police said a South Florida pizza delivery man escaped an alleged armed robbery by throwing a piping-hot pizza at his attacker.

Investigators said a gunman ordered Eric Lopez Devictoria, 40, to enter a Miramar residence while he was on a delivery call shortly before 1 p.m. Wednesday, the South Florida Sun-Sentinel reported Friday.

Devictoria told police he lobbed the pizza at the gunman and heard at least one shot as he fled from the home.

Police said two 16-year-old boys and a 17-year-old boy were arrested a short time later and charged with armed robbery.
